1.图标

<button type="button" class="btn btn-default">

<span class="glyphicon glyphicon-sort-by-attributes"></span>

</button>

2下拉列表

<div class="dropdown">

<button type="button" class="btn dropdown-toggle" id="dropdownMenu1"

data-toggle="dropdown">

主题

<span class="caret"></span>

</button>

<ul class="dropdown-menu" role="menu" >

<li role="presentation" class="dropdown-header">下拉菜单标题</li>

<li role="presentation" >

<a role="menuitem" tabindex="-1" href="#">Java</a>

</li>

<li role="presentation">

<a role="menuitem" tabindex="-1" href="#">数据挖掘</a>

</li>

<li role="presentation">

<a role="menuitem" tabindex="-1" href="#">

数据通信/网络

</a>

</li>

<li role="presentation" class="divider"></li>

<li role="presentation" class="dropdown-header">下拉菜单标题</li>

<li role="presentation">

<a role="menuitem" tabindex="-1" href="#">分离的链接</a>

</li>

</ul>

</div>

3.按钮组

<div class="btn-toolbar" role="toolbar">

<div class="btn-group">

<button type="button" class="btn btn-default">按钮 1</button>

<button type="button" class="btn btn-default">按钮 2</button>

<button type="button" class="btn btn-default">按钮 3</button>

</div>

<div class="btn-group">

<button type="button" class="btn btn-default">按钮 4</button>

<button type="button" class="btn btn-default">按钮 5</button>

<button type="button" class="btn btn-default">按钮 6</button>

</div>

<div class="btn-group">

<button type="button" class="btn btn-default">按钮 7</button>

<button type="button" class="btn btn-default">按钮 8</button>

<button type="button" class="btn btn-default">按钮 9</button>

</div>

</div>

4.输入框组

<div class="input-group">

<span class="input-group-addon">@</span>

<input type="text" class="form-control" placeholder="twitterhandle">

</div>

把按钮作为输入框组的前缀或者后缀元素,这个时候您就不是添加 .input-group-addon class,您需要使用 class .input-group-btn 来包裹按钮。

这是必需的,因为默认的浏览器样式不会被重写。

<div class="input-group">

<span class="input-group-btn">

<button class="btn btn-default" type="button">

Go!

</button>

</span>

<input type="text" class="form-control">

</div><!-- /input-group -->

5.Bootstrap 导航元素

<ul class="nav nav-tabs">

<li class="active"><a href="#">Home</a></li>

<li><a href="#">SVN</a></li>

<li><a href="#">iOS</a></li>

<li><a href="#">VB.Net</a></li>

<li><a href="#">Java</a></li>

<li><a href="#">PHP</a></li>

</ul>

表格导航或标签(nav-tabs)

胶囊式的导航菜单(nav-pills)

垂直的(nav-stacked)

两端对齐的导航

您可以在屏幕宽度大于 768px 时,通过在分别使用 .nav、.nav-tabs 或 .nav、.nav-pills 的同时使用 class .nav-justified,让标签式或胶囊式导航菜单与父元素等宽。在更小的屏幕上,导航链接会堆叠。

禁用链接

对每个 .nav class,如果添加了 .disabled class,则会创建一个灰色的链接,同时禁用了该链接的 :hover 状态,

6.导航栏

<nav class="navbar navbar-default" role="navigation">

<div class="navbar-header">

<a class="navbar-brand" href="#">W3Cschool</a>

</div>

<div>

<ul class="nav navbar-nav">

<li class="active"><a href="#">iOS</a></li>

<li><a href="#">SVN</a></li>

<li class="dropdown">

<a href="#" class="dropdown-toggle" data-toggle="dropdown">

Java

<b class="caret"></b>

</a>

<ul class="dropdown-menu">

<li><a href="#">jmeter</a></li>

<li><a href="#">EJB</a></li>

<li><a href="#">Jasper Report</a></li>

<li class="divider"></li>

<li><a href="#">分离的链接</a></li>

<li class="divider"></li>

<li><a href="#">另一个分离的链接</a></li>

</ul>

</li>

</ul>

</div>

</nav>

响应式:您要折叠的内容必须包裹在带有 classes .collapse、.navbar-collapse 的 <div> 中。

折叠起来的导航栏实际上是一个带有 class .navbar-toggle 及两个 data- 元素的按钮。

第一个是 data-toggle,用于告诉 JavaScript 需要对按钮做什么,

第二个是 data-target,指示要切换到哪一个元素。三个带有 class .icon-bar 的 <span> 创建所谓的汉堡按钮。这些会切换为 .nav-collapse <div> 中的元素。

导航栏中的表单:使用 .navbar-form class。这确保了表单适当的垂直对齐和在较窄的视口中折叠的行为

固定到顶部:让导航栏固定在页面的顶部,请向 .navbar class 添加 class .navbar-fixed-top。

7.Bootstrap 面包屑导航(Breadcrumbs)

<ol class="breadcrumb">

<li><a href="#">Home</a></li>

<li><a href="#">2013</a></li>

<li class="active">十一月</li>

</ol>

8.分页

<ul class="pagination">

<li><a href="#">&laquo;</a></li>

<li><a href="#">1</a></li>

<li><a href="#">2</a></li>

<li><a href="#">3</a></li>

<li><a href="#">4</a></li>

<li><a href="#">5</a></li>

<li><a href="#">&raquo;</a></li>

</ul>

分页的状态     class .disabled、.active

分页的大小     class .pagination-*

.pager                         添加该 class 来获得翻页链接。

.previous, .next        使用 class .previous 把链接向左对齐,使用 .next 把链接向右对齐。

.disabled           添加该 class 来获得一个颜色变淡的外观。

9.Bootstrap 标签   class .label

10.Bootstrap 徽章(Badges)

徽章(Badges)主要用于突出显示新的或未读的项。

如需使用徽章,只需要把 <span class="badge"> 添加到链接、Bootstrap 导航等这些元素上即可。

当没有新的或未读的项时,通过 CSS 的 :empty 选择器,徽章会折叠起来,表示里边没有内容。

激活导航状态         <span class="badge"> 来激活链接

11.Bootstrap 超大屏幕(Jumbotron)

.jumbotron class

为了获得占用全部宽度且不带圆角的超大屏幕,请在所有的 .container class 外使用 .jumbotron class

12.Bootstrap 页面标题(Page Header)

<div class="page-header">

<h1>页面标题实例

<small>子标题</small>

</h1>

</div>

13.Bootstrap 缩略图

<div class="col-sm-6 col-md-3">

<a href="#" class="thumbnail">

<img src="/wp-content/uploads/2014/06/kittens.jpg"

alt="通用的占位符缩略图">

</a>

</div>

14.Bootstrap 警告(Alerts)

创建一个 <div>,并向其添加一个 .alert class 和

四个上下文 class(即 .alert-success、.alert-info、.alert-warning、.alert-danger)之一,来添加一个基本的警告框。

15.进度条

<div class="progress">

<div class="progress-bar" role="progressbar"  style="width: 40%;">

<span class="sr-only">40% 完成</span>

</div>

</div>

16.Bootstrap 列表组

<ul class="list-group">

<li class="list-group-item">免费域名注册</li>

<li class="list-group-item">免费 Window 空间托管</li>

</ul>

17.Bootstrap 面板(Panels)

只需要向 <div> 元素添加 class .panel 和 class .panel-default 即可

18.Bootstrap Well

Well 是一种会引起内容凹陷显示或插图效果的容器 <div>

3.bootstrap-组件的更多相关文章

  1. JS组件系列——Bootstrap组件福利篇:几款好用的组件推荐(二)

    前言:上篇 JS组件系列——Bootstrap组件福利篇:几款好用的组件推荐 分享了几个项目中比较常用的组件,引起了许多园友的关注.这篇还是继续,因为博主觉得还有几个非常简单.实用的组件,实在不愿自己 ...

  2. bootstrap学习笔记--bootstrap组件

    前面已经学习了bootstrap环境搭建以及基本布局方面的知识,下面将学习下关于bootstrap的相关组件,知识点有点多. 关于bootstrap组件知识点目录: Bootstrap--代码显示 B ...

  3. bootstrap 组件

      bootstrap  组件 1下拉菜单(dropdown)  下拉菜单切换(dropdown-toggle)  下拉菜单对齐(dropdown-menu-right-右对齐) 下拉菜单分割线(di ...

  4. Bootstrap组件

    1.Bootstrap组件——Glyphicons图标字体 图标字体:可以表示的文字不是abcd或1234,而是一个又一个图形符号,比直接使用图片好处:可以任意放大不会失真:所有能使用文字的地方都可以 ...

  5. ASP.NET MVC使用Bootstrap系列(3)——使用Bootstrap 组件

    阅读目录 Bootstrap 导航条 列表组 徽章 媒体对象 页头 路径导航 分页 输入框组 按钮式下拉菜单 警告框 进度条 小结 Bootstrap为我们提供了十几种的可复用组件,包括字体图标.下拉 ...

  6. bootstrap组件 2

    bootstrap组件2 <!DOCTYPE html> <html lang="zh-cn"> <head > <meta charse ...

  7. bootstrap组件学习

    转自http://v3.bootcss.com/components/ bootstrap组件学习 矢量图标的用法<span class="glyphicon glyphicon-se ...

  8. UIBootatrap:是由AngularJS UI团队编写的纯AngularJS实现的Bootstrap组件

    本文为翻译文档.原文是https://angular-ui.github.io/bootstrap/(需要FQ). 准备工作: 依赖关系:这个库中包含一组基于Bootstrap组件和CSS的原生Ang ...

  9. Angular -ui - BootStrap组件的解释以及使用

    关于UI BootStrap UI BootStrap 是angularUI团队用纯粹angularJS语法编写的Bootstrap组件. 1. 关于ng-router(angular-router. ...

  10. python 全栈开发,Day58(bootstrap组件,bootstrap JavaScript 插件,后台模板,图表插件,jQuery插件库,Animate.css,swiper,运行vue项目)

    一.bootstrap组件 无数可复用的组件,包括字体图标.下拉菜单.导航.警告框.弹出框等更多功能. 组件和插件的区别? 插件:一个功能,比如js文件 组件:html css js 组件包含插件 面 ...

随机推荐

  1. windows下命令行模式中cd命令无效的原因

    当我们执行cmd 想切换当前工作目录时,会发现windows下命令行模式中cd命令没有生效,到底是什么原因呢? 例如: 当我们想切换到 D:\MySql\mysql-5.7.19-winx64\bin ...

  2. SpringMVC + Mybatis bug调试 SQL正确,查数据库却返回NULL

    今天碰到个bug,有点意思 背景是SpringMVC + Mybatis的一个项目,mapper文件里写了一条sql 大概相当于 select a from tableA where b = &quo ...

  3. postgresql如何维护WAL日志/归档日志

    WAL日志介绍 wal全称是write ahead log,是postgresql中的online redo log,是为了保证数据库中数据的一致性和事务的完整性.而在PostgreSQL 7中引入的 ...

  4. 自己为什么注册博客(csdn讲师:Array)

    记录生活,记录技术,记录青春. 势若在己,则人力可以至:势若在人,则忧心亦无益. 倘若势不在己,该怎么办? 天下之势,本如流水.若流于他处,则处心积虑,断流开源,独占大势. 这是一个最好的时代,也是一 ...

  5. webpack常见的配置总结 ---只是一些常见的配置

    早期的构建工具grunt ,gulp 帮助我们配置一些开发环境,省去一些我们调试和重复的工作 现在我们的构建工具一般是webpack ,目前建议大家用3.0以上的版本 现在市场上比较优秀的构建工具,个 ...

  6. eclipse创建的maven项目无法部署到tomcat

    今天在eclipse中创建了个maven项目,想运行起来看看,发现代码开发完成后无法发布到tomcat. 解决办法如下: 第一种: 选中项目-右键属性-Project Facets 勾选上面三项并选择 ...

  7. jdbc预编译

    详见:http://blog.yemou.net/article/query/info/tytfjhfascvhzxcytp20 JAVA_JDBC预编译 相关知识点 什么是预编译语句? 预编译语句P ...

  8. Google推出移动网页开发者认证考试 价格99美元

    如果您是移动网页开发人员,希望了解您的编码实力,Google将推出一个认证流程,让您可以参加考试,如果您通过,可以在您的简历,网站和其他在线上显示电子徽章配置文件.           此外,潜在的雇 ...

  9. Linux-chmod命令(4)

     chmod:(change mode)改变linux系统文件或目录的访问权限.用它控制文件或目录的访问权限. 格式 : [-cfvR][[+-=][rwxX]...][,...] 参数 1:  -c ...

  10. 使用JavaScript循环嵌套解决各种图形

    [循环嵌套的规律]    1.外层循环控制行数,内层循环控制每行中元素的个数. [图形题思路]    1.确定图形有几行,行数即为外层循环次数:    2.确定每行中有几种元素组成,有几种元素表示有几 ...